History & Origin
Artyom is the Russian form of Artemios/Artemius — from Greek artemes, 'safe, healthy, whole, vigorous' (associated with the goddess Artemis). A strong, popular classic across Russia (said 'ar-TYOM').
In the U.S. it appears in Russian families. Rare, healthy-and-whole at the root, and strong.

Frequently Asked
What does the name Artyom mean?
Artyom is the Russian Artemios — Greek 'safe, healthy, whole, vigorous'.
How do you pronounce Artyom?
It's said ar-TYOM /ɑrˈtjɔm/ — two syllables, stress on the second.
Is Artyom a boy or girl name?
Artyom is a boy's name.
How popular is Artyom?
Artyom is a rare name in the U.S.
